How much do driver ass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for driver assistant in Boca Raton, FL is $16.07,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.38 and $17.36 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the duties of a driver assistant?

A driver assistant supports the driver by helping with loading and unloading cargo, ensuring safety protocols are followed, and assisting with navigation or communication tasks. They may also perform vehicle inspections and maintain cleanliness, often working in environments that require good communication skills and attention to detail.

What are the typical challenges faced by a driver assistant during daily routes?

Driver Assistants often encounter challenges such as navigating heavy traffic, managing time efficiently to meet tight delivery schedules, and handling heavy or awkward packages safely. They work closely with drivers to ensure smooth loading and unloading, maintain accurate delivery records, and provide excellent customer service at each stop. Adaptability and strong communication skills are key, as routes and tasks can change unexpectedly due to weather or customer requests.

What is a driver assistant?

As a driver assistant, you help truck drivers with all aspect of their jobs, barring driving the truck itself. Although you do not typically drive, you are responsible for road safety, safe cargo stowage, and occasional product assembly. You often work independently to load and unload goods from trucks at the receiving company. Becoming a driver assistant does not require you have formal qualifications or education, but prior experience in warehouse environments can set you ahead of other candidates. Duties typically include handling heavy loads, working flexible hours, and performing regular safety inspections. Most driver’s assistants use the skills and experience they gain to move on to a career as a driver, or a supervisory position within a warehouse.

We are seeking a reliable and proactive Helper to work alongside a Solid Waste Driver to assist with the collection and loading of refuse and recyclable materials from residential and commercial customers. This position is physically demanding and requires a strong commitment to safety and customer service.


***This is not a DRIVER role.

Requirements

  • Collect and load refuse or recyclables from customer locations using carts or front-load containers for hydraulic emptying by the truck.
     
  • Accompany drivers on assigned local pickup routes and assist with daily route completion.
     
  • Communicate pickup updates to customers, drivers, and dispatch as needed.
     
  • Load the truck in a safe and efficient manner, ensuring all materials match work orders.
     
  • Climb in and out of the truck cab frequently throughout the day to accommodate customer pickups.
     
  • Obtain pickup confirmations through manual or electronic methods using a handheld tablet device.
     
  • Maintain accurate and timely updates on all orders and route progress.
     
  • Assist the driver when maneuvering the truck into tight or complex positions for pickup.
     
  • Safely lift, push, and pull bags or receptacles weighing 50-75+ pounds on a consistent basis.
     
  • Adhere to all company safety standards and use required personal protective equipment (PPE) at all times.
